Sick Verse

Mordant, black-humoured or horrific works such as Edgar Allan Poe's "The Raven," Robert Browning's "`Childe Roland to the Dark Tower Came'," and Robert Service's "The Cremation of Sam McGee." This term was popularized by George Macbeth's anthology Penguin Book of Sick Verse (1963).
